Superinduction of cytosolic and chromatin-bound ornithine decarboxylase activities of germinating barley seeds by actinomycin D

Putrescine in plant cells is formed either from Larginine by L-arginine decarboxylase (EC 4.11.19, ADC) or directly from L-ornithine by L-ornithine decarboxylase (EC 4.11.17, ODC) [1-5]. The contribution of ODC to the formation of polyamines in plants was claimed to be insignificant, since ODC activity in most plant tissues was found to be much lower than that of ADC [6]. The only welldocumented work on ODC activity in plant cells is that in [4] on rapidly proliferating plant cells. Investigations to now on plant ODC were performed in the 10000 × g supernatant of plant tissue homogenates based on the assumption that ODC is a cytosolic enzyme. Here, evidence is presented that in barley seeds germinated for > 90 h, ODC activity is located mainly in the nucleus, tightly bound to chromatin, although the cytosol also possesses considerable activity. Both activities are superinduced when seed germination takes place in the presence of gibberellic acid and actinomycin D.
